Everton fans have taken to Twitter to type some hard-hitting comments towards Tom Davies for his performance against Leicester.

The Toffees threw away a 1-0 lead to lose 2-1 to Brendan Rodgers' side in stoppage time, after Kelechi Iheanacho slotted past Jordan Pickford with seconds left on the clock.

The defeat means that Marco Silva has now only won two of his last ten Premier League games as Everton's boss, and four in total across the league campaign - the Merseysiders sit 17th, just two points off the bottom three.

Davies in particular wasn't in the best of form, to say the least.

The Everton academy graduate completed just 70.6% of his passes, while also seeing just two of his attempted five long balls come off.

Davies, 21, missed his tackle in the build-up to Jamie Vardy's equaliser, and was simply anonymous throughout the 90 minutes as Wilfried Ndidi on the opposition side bossed the midfield battle.

One fan said that Davies "should never wear the shirt again" with another Everton supporter stating that the youngster delivered the worst performance they have even seen.
